Tasting notes
Deep, brilliant magenta. Powerful, spice-accented aromas of ripe dark berries, cherry-cola, lavender, pungent herbs and licorice are energized by a smoky mineral top note. Densely packed and concentrated, offering intense, alluringly sweet blueberry, cherry liqueur and floral pastille flavors that show superb detail and mineral cut. Finishes with resonating florality, youthfully gripping tannins and outstanding, mineral-driven tenacity. All whole clusters and one-third new oak. (JR)

Deep, dark, rich, showy, full-bodied, intense wine with layers of black raspberries, kirsch, and plums that fill your palate with its ocean of fruit. Even with all of its concentration and richness, everything remains in balance, leaving you with a rich, fruit-packed finish. Drink from 2023-2035.
The 2019 Gigondas Hominis Fides is cut from the same cloth and has power, purity, and elegance. Ground herbs, Provençal spice, black raspberries, blackberries, and assorted peppery notes give way to a full-bodied, concentrated Gigondas with a great mid-palate, perfect balance, and a great finish. It has some charm today, but smart money will hide bottles for a few years.
95% Grenache, 5% Syrah. Aged in oak barrels, 30% new. Organic. Barrel sample. Tasted blind. Fresh fruit – lots of generosity here. Tight fruit on the mid palate and plenty of potential. Chewy fruit dominates but huge power. Big style – needs plenty of time to come together. Very ripe and structured at the same time. So much power here to resolve. (AC)
